Customer service

Amazon is renowned for its customer support, but it is not always available when you need it the most. This is especially true if you're a seller who utilizes Fulfillment by Amazon or Seller Fulfilled Prime. FBA is a fulfilment programme for eCommerce that enables sellers to ship their products to Amazon's warehouses. Amazon will manage picking and warehousing of the goods packaging, as well as fulfillment. SFP is similar to FBA, but it allows sellers to remain in control of their own fulfillment operations, while also enjoying benefits like Prime shipping.

Click the Help button to reach Amazon customer service if you are experiencing problems with your order or delivery. This will open a window that has a number of options. Select the option which best suits your needs. If you'd like to chat to a live person Click Help via chat. If you prefer using email, click Contact Us.

Before you reach out to Amazon ensure that you have your receipt along with the item number and payment information in your wallet. This will save you time and money. Amazon has a FAQ section which provides answers to the most common questions. You can search the site using keywords to find articles that answer your questions.
